Yuri anime is a genre of anime that focuses on romantic relationships between female characters. The term “yuri” originates from the Japanese word for “lily” and is often used to refer to lesbian relationships in anime and manga.

Yuri anime explores a range of themes related to love, identity, and personal growth, and often features complex and nuanced portrayals of female characters. It can range from subtle and understated depictions of same-sex attraction to more explicit and overtly romantic relationships.

In recent years, yuri anime has gained popularity both in Japan and abroad, and has helped to push for greater representation of LGBTQ+ characters in anime and manga.
